Job description

Hours: Monday - Friday Shifts between6:30 am - 6:00 pm(Up to 33.75 hours/week -supply work, no guarantee of hours)
Program Support:
  • Maintains a safe, nurturing environment, conducive to child development in all areas of the program, including the playroom, washroom, cloakroom, lunchroom, sleep room and during outdoor play.
Assist with implementing developmentally appropriate educational programs for children including:
  • Assisting with the arranging playroom equipment for various indoor and outdoor activities.
  • Cleaning toys, equipment, and cupboards as required.
  • Assisting in moving and storing equipment according to the requirements of the location.
  • Assisting with and attending parent/teacher activities.

  • Carries out daily routines such as toileting, preparing and serving snacks and lunches for all children and directs children in the general tidiness of the playroom and housekeeping in all areas.
  • Recognizes unusual behaviour in children and anticipates problem situations to take preventative and remedial action under the guidance of ECE staff.
  • Reports child protection concerns to Family and Children’s Services Niagara.
  • Ensures adequate sanitary and housekeeping standards are maintained and performs vacuuming, loading or unloading the dishwasher and other housekeeping duties.
  • Completes visual health and safety inspections on a regular basis.
  • Records attendance daily and completes health incident forms for children in their care as needed.
  • Informs the Day Care Team Lead of situations which affect the efficient operation of the program or have implications for the Agency.

Team Building:
  • Actively participates and engages in team and staff meetings and training sessions.
  • Supports the team and works with team members to ensure department and children needs are met
Other Related Activities:
  • Knows and adheres to all applicable FACS policies, procedures, and relevant administrative practices.
  • Strives to exceed all accountabilities and achieve continuous quality improvement and excellence in all activities and outcomes.
  • Ensures own expenditures adhere to FACS policies.
  • Participates in mandatory learning/education to maintain and update skills and knowledge as required.
  • Assists in the training and orientation of peers, acts as mentor and role model to students/volunteers from education facilities and volunteer agencies.
  • Works in compliance with the provisions of the Occupational Health and Safety Act of Ontario and the regulations.
  • Performs office duties such as answering the phones and checking the daily log to ensure high quality of service for families, documents messages and records parent’s inquiries.
  • Opens (unlocks) and closes (locks) the premises as required; keeping exits free of snow or other play equipment as necessary.
  • Performs other duties as required.
Qualifications:
  • High School Diploma
  • Experience working with children, youth and families
  • Valid standard First Aid and CPR Certificate (preferred)
  • Valid G Driver’s License and access to a reliable motor vehicle with appropriate liability insurance
About FACS Niagara
A lot has changed in our community and our world since the founding of Family and Children’s Services Niagara in 1898, but our organization’s commitment to safe kids and strong families holds true. Through an extensive portfolio of programming, including child protection, fostering and adoption, counselling, and childcare, FACS Niagara protects our community’s children, strengthens its families, and helps youth and adults achieve their full potential.
In the Ministry of Community, Children and Social Services 2021 Annual Review, FACS Niagara was recognized for:
100% compliance related to children and youth placed in extended society care for 24 consecutive months
100% compliance related to all Indigenous service requirements
